Transaction

24c24d35a5e70ffd9ef39094aed122d3aba585754a4e138cd0becdfe603e99d4
248,610 confirmations
Timestamp
1621689216
Block684,538
Fee245,526 sats
Fee rate117.5 sats/vB
view on mempool.space

Inputs & Outputs

Outputs